  1. A two-wheeled horse-drawn vehicle in which passengers sit on a pair of benches. archaic,historical
    — Then we went, my Lord on horseback and the rest of us partly walking, partly on a most social machine, the Irish car, running upon two low, broad wheels, covered by a spacious platform rendered comfortable by carpeting fixed over it, and on the three sides not next the horse, boards to support the feet on.
